77问答网
所有问题
当前搜索:
如何用冒泡法排序数组
冒泡法怎么
对10个数由小到大进行
排序
?
答:
冒泡法对10个数由小到大排序:a=rand(1,10);%随机生成一组数
a%未排序前原始数据 n=10;%数组长度 forj=1:n-1 fori=1:n-1 ifa(i)>a(i+1)c=a(i);a(i)=a(i+1);a(i+1)=c;end end end a%排序后数组显示 资料拓展 冒泡法排序原理:例如有一组数为12,23,1,4,2,6。使...
如何使用冒泡排序
实现对
数组排序
?
答:
这个函数接受一个整数数组作为输入,并返回一个已排序的数组
。你可以通过调用这个函数并传入你想要排序的数字序列来使用这个算法。例如:water = [5, 3, 8, 2, 7, 6] sorted_water = bubble_sort(water) print(sorted_water) # 输出:[2, 3, 5, 6, 7, 8]当然,还有其他更高效的排序算法...
用冒泡法
对
数组
的元素进行由大到小进行
排序
?
答:
用冒泡法对数组的元素进行由大到小进行排序
,函数void sort (int array[] ,int n)为排序,形式参数为数组名和数组元素的个数,算法用冒泡法。在main函数中,通过键盘输入10个数,赋值给数组,然后调用sort函数进行排序,最后依次输出数组排序后的元素。 vo... 展开 kowinner | 浏览4098 次 |举报 我有更好的答案推...
如何
对一个长度为10的
数组
进行
冒泡排序
?
答:
创建两个变量start、end,记住数组起始与结束位置元素的地址,应用两次 while 循环交换地址
指针冒泡排序 :void PrintArr(int* arr, int sz){ int i = 0;for (i = 0; i < sz; i++){ printf("%d ", *(arr + i));} return 0;} void BubbleSort(int *arr, int sz){ int start...
冒泡排序
的实现过程有哪些?
答:
采用冒泡法
降序
排列
10个输入数据的程序如下:先定义一个长度为10的
数组
a[],10个数据由键盘输入,从第一个数开始,两两一组进行判断,因为要求是降序排列,因此将两个数中小的向后移动,每个数要比较的次数为9-数的下标。比较完成后将数组依次输出。输入10个数据,程序运行结果:...
冒泡排序法
是
如何排序
的???
答:
冒泡排序
算法的原理:1、比较相邻的元素。如果第一个比第二个大,就交换他们两个。2、对每一对相邻元素做同样的工作,从开始第一对到结尾的最后一对。在这一点,最后的元素应该会是最大的数。3、针对所有的元素重复以上的步骤,除了最后一个。4、持续每次对越来越少的元素重复上面的步骤,直到没有...
c语言
使用冒泡排序
将一维
数组
A中的N个元素升序
排列
答:
我这给出一个不用指针,不用手动分配内存空间的相对 精简易懂 的方法#include <stdio.h>int main(){ int N,A[N]; int i,j,temp; printf("请输入
数组
大小!\n");scanf("%d",&N);printf("请为%d个元素赋值\n",N); for(i=0;i<N;i++)scanf("%d",&A[i]); for(i=0;i<N;i++)for(j...
C语言编程高手请进!
用冒泡法
对20个数进行
排序
答:
冒泡
? 首先你要将你
排序
的二十个数放到
数组
int Num[](以整型为例。如果有小数: double Num[]) 里面。然后定义排序的函数: Sort(int Num[],int n); 第一个参数是你要排序的数组,第二个就是数组里面数的个数。函数实现: Sort(int Num[],int n){ for(int i=0;i<n;i...
用冒泡排序法
对输入的10个数进行升序排序 并存入
数组
中
答:
define elemType int /*元素类型*//*
冒泡排序
*/ /* 1. 从当前元素起,向后依次比较每一对相邻元素,若逆序则交换 */ /* 2. 对所有元素均重复以上步骤,直至最后一个元素 */ /* elemType arr[]: 排序目标
数组
; int len: 元素个数 */ void bubbleSort (elemType arr[], int len) { ...
用冒泡排序法
对输入的10个数进行升序排序 并存入
数组
中
答:
1、打开sublime text 3,点击左上方的“文件”,选择“新建文件”,新建一个后缀名为.html的文件,并命名标题。2、在Body中添加一个简单的input按钮,添加一个点击事件my
maopao
,用来在浏览器中查看效果。3、定义两个变量i,j。
使用
两个for循环嵌套遍历
数组
,第一个i作用为循环次数,第二个j作用是...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
用冒泡排序法对数组排序
编写函数用冒泡排序法对数组
用冒泡法对数组a进行排序
用冒泡法对数组由小到大排序
用冒泡法对数组a进行从小到大排序
编写函数用冒泡法或者选择排序法
数组冒泡法排序
冒泡法对数组进行排序
二维数组的冒泡法排序